Output 13f4d2bbeaa6fc179d3f99f37e4ec00a15ab991a95e6a43248c2419cdc1418dd:10

value
2719756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ab222c4f9de6fbcc15180d1bd25b2bf9cb7f038a OP_EQUAL
address
3HHtQjZfXtZkyLUedbmfuwmVTUikhFrH5o
transaction
13f4d2bbeaa6fc179d3f99f37e4ec00a15ab991a95e6a43248c2419cdc1418dd
confirmations
489820
spent
true